($754) Cost to ship a car from Huntsville, AL to New Haven, CT
Quick answer: The average cost to ship a car 1,004 miles from Huntsville, Alabama, to New Haven, Connecticut, ranges from $754 to $1,270. Costs vary depending on factors like the type of vehicle, transport method, and time of year. For a more detailed quote, use our car shipping cost calculator.

How we chose the best car shipping companies
We analyzed 2,400 car shipping companies nationally and evaluated and rated them based on key factors using our unique system of methodology.
Here’s what we considered:
- Standard services: We looked at the types and variety of services each company provides. This includes whether they offer open transport, enclosed transport, or both. We also rated companies based on whether they have door-to-door shipping or just terminal pickup and delivery and the kinds of vehicles they ship. Companies that move RVs, motorcycles, and other specialty vehicles scored higher than those that just ship cars.
- Add-on services: We gave additional points to companies that provide special optional services like expedited shipping, guaranteed pickup times, car washes, and rental car reimbursement.
- Customer satisfaction: We analyzed consumer reviews on multiple major platforms, such as Yelp, Google, and Trustpilot to see whether a car shipping company delivers services promptly with good communication and within the estimated cost. We also evaluated each company’s standing within the car shipping industry as a whole by confirming U.S. Department of Transportation (USDOT) licensure and checked their membership in — and reputation with — trade associations.
- Availability: We awarded points to each company based on their service areas. Companies that are available in Alaska and Hawaii, in addition to the continental U.S., scored higher than those that just service the Lower 48 or fewer states.
- Scheduling and payment: We reviewed the ease with which customers can schedule services and estimate their costs through accurate quotes, price matching, flat-rate pricing, and other perks. Car shippers that give binding quotes or a price-lock promise got more positive rankings than those that are not as transparent with pricing.
Car shipping alternatives from AL to CT
When you’re moving from Huntsville to New Haven, there are several ways to get your car to your new home. Here are the most common car shipping alternatives. Each one has its own benefits and trade-offs.
Coordinate with your movers
On moves from Huntsville to New Haven, it’s common for the top long-distance movers to coordinate with established car shippers for you. This can simplify your relocation, but you might not have a say in which car shipper they choose.
Drive your car
Choosing whether to drive or ship your vehicle involves trade-offs. The 1,004 miles from Huntsville to New Haven might make for an enjoyable road trip and save you money. But the downsides include added wear on your car and potential risks from weather or long-distance driving.
Use a driving service
Hiring someone else to drive your car directly from Alabama to Connecticut is an option, albeit an expensive one. And you’ll need to find a driver you trust to safely get your car from Huntsville to New Haven. Plus, you’ll still be putting extra miles on your car regardless of who drives it there.
Ship your car via train
Shipping a car by train is a cost-effective and safe way to transport your vehicle to New Haven, particularly if you’re already planning to move your household belongings by rail. In fact, it is the cheapest way to ship your car! Keep in mind that this method offers no real flexibility in terms of pickup and drop-off locations and will take longer than using a car shipper or driving.
Factors affecting Huntsville to New Haven car shipping costs
When you’re arranging vehicle transport from Huntsville to New Haven, keep these cost factors in mind:
Transport method
If you’re moving a car from Huntsville to New Haven, your options include open, enclosed, and top-loaded shipping. Each service has pros and cons depending on your situation.
Open carriers from Huntsville tend to be the most budget-friendly, while enclosed transport is better for protecting luxury or classic cars. To help you decide on the right choice for your move to New Haven, see our detailed guide on open vs. enclosed transport.
Vehicle size and type
Your shipping price from Huntsville depends heavily on your car’s size and weight. The larger the vehicle, the higher the cost, since it takes up more space on the carrier. For instance, a full-size SUV headed to New Haven will cost significantly more to ship than a compact car.
Distance and route
To put it simply, the longer the journey, the higher the price. Distance impacts pricing in terms of fuel and labor expenses, as well as added costs like toll fees and carrier maintenance. Shipping your car 1,004 miles from Huntsville to New Haven will likely be more expensive than transporting it a shorter distance within Alabama.
Where you’re shipping your car matters, too. Rates are usually lower for routes along major highways and higher for more remote areas.
The time of the year
Car shipping prices fluctuate with the seasons and the weather in both Huntsville and New Haven.
Huntsville experiences hot, humid summers and generally mild winters. Huntsville is located in tornado alley.
Best months to move to New Haven are June, September and August as these are the best months with tolerable weather. January and February are the least comfortable months as these are the coldest months.
During busy moving periods—such as summertime or around winter holidays—demand spikes, and so do costs. Moving your car from Huntsville to New Haven during these times can be more expensive.
Fuel prices
Fuel price fluctuations can greatly influence transport costs. This is a critical factor given the 1,004-mile distance between Huntsville and New Haven and the varying fuel prices across different regions. When fuel prices are high, shipping costs will rise accordingly.
Delivery expectations
Being flexible with your delivery dates can sometimes lead to discounts from your auto shipper. However, shipping a car from Huntsville to New Haven typically takes between two and eight days. Flexibility in delivery times can save costs, whereas expedited services ensure quicker delivery but at a premium cost.
Comparing Huntsville and New Haven vehicle regulations
Parking permits
- Huntsville: $0.50 per hour All parking meters are enforced Monday through Friday 8 a.m. – 5 p.m. Meters are not enforced on City of Huntsville’s recognized holidays.
- New Haven: Check with the City of New Haven for details about parking permits and restrictions that you should know about before your move to New Haven.
Car insurance requirements
- Huntsville: Alabama state government requires motorists possess liability insurance, which must provide a minimum coverage of 25/50/25. This specification includes coverage for bodily injury per person, bodily injury per accident, and property damage per accident.
- New Haven: The basic car insurance requirements in the state of Connecticut is as follow: Bodily injury liability: $25,000 per person, $50,000 per accident Property damage liability: $25,000 per accident Uninsured/underinsured motorist: $25,000 per person, $50,000 per accident
Vehicle inspections
- Huntsville: In Alabama, a safety inspection must be completed prior to selling a vehicle and a VIN inspection is mandatory when registering an out-of-state vehicle. Emissions inspections are not required by the state, though cities and municipalities may have their own laws mandating them.
- New Haven: In Connecticut, all vehicles must undergo an emissions inspection every two years, with a few exceptions. Additionally, a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) inspection, which confirms the vehicle's identity, is required when registering the vehicle in the state.
Driver’s license
- Huntsville: When you move to Alabama with an out-of-state driver's license, you have 30 days to surrender it and obtain an Alabama license.
- New Haven: As a new resident of Connecticut, you must obtain a Connecticut driver's license within 30 days. Residency is defined as living in the state for over 6 months in a year.
FAQ
How much does it cost to ship a car from Huntsville to New Haven?
The cost to ship a car from Huntsville, AL to New Haven, CT varies based on several factors, including the type of transport (open vs. enclosed car shipping), vehicle size and weight, and the current fuel prices. On average, transporting your vehicle from Huntsville to New Haven will range from $754 to $1,270.
How long will it take to ship my car from Huntsville to New Haven?
It will take approximately two to eight days to ship your car the 1,004 miles from Huntsville to New Haven. If you need it quicker, ask your shipper about expedited delivery.
What’s the cheapest way to ship my car from Huntsville to New Haven?
An open-transport car carrier is the cheapest way to ship your car from Huntsville to New Haven. However, there are other methods. Read our post on the cheapest way to ship a car to learn more.
Is it cheaper to ship my car or drive it from Huntsville to New Haven?
It is generally cheaper to drive your car from Huntsville to New Haven than to ship it. However, when deciding whether to drive your car or ship it, you need to factor in related costs like maintenance fees that could result from the additional wear-and-tear on your vehicle during the 1,004-mile trip. Long-distance trips also involve food and possibly lodging, which can add up quickly.
